The Zoe is Ghost Rock's sparkling side and it's a charming one. Pale salmon in the glass, with orchard fruits, strawberry, and honey biscuit on the nose. Fresh and lively on the palate, with citrus acidity and gentle sweetness in perfect balance. From Ghost Rock's wild West Coast estate, this is a sparkling rosé with real personality. Pair with fresh seafood, soft cheeses, or light canapés. Drink now through 2026.

Meet the owners

Ghost Rock's story started small, a modest vineyard planted in the corner of Cate and Colin Arnold's potato farm at Northdown in 1999. Over the following two decades, the family all but built Tasmania's Cradle Coast wine region from scratch, planting patch by patch with no formal training, just persistence and a feel for the land. Today son Justin and his wife Alicia run the show, with Justin's winemaking experience spanning the Yarra Valley, Margaret River and California's Napa Valley. The wines, mostly Pinot Noir and Chardonnay, are grown, made and bottled entirely on site.

About the region

Wild wilderness, ancient rainforests, rugged mountains and windswept coasts, this is Tasmania's West Coast. It's the smallest and newest wine region on the island, home to just a handful of producers making cool climate wines of genuine character. Pinot Noir, Chardonnay, Riesling and Pinot Gris are the varieties that thrive here, shaped by one of the most dramatic landscapes on earth.
